About The Role
We are looking for an experienced Customer Success Manager (CSM) with a technical background to join our International Post-Sales team and be our founding CSM in our growing Asia Pacific region. As the first CSM in the region, we are looking for someone who can operate in a fluid environment, going outside the bounds of the job description to ensure customers are getting the technical and operational support they need to recognise value from their Highspot investment.

CSM's play a crucial role in ensuring customer satisfaction, retention, and ongoing success. Their primary focus is to build strong relationships with customers, understand their needs, and help them derive maximum value from the products or services offered by the company.

They will deliver essential customer-facing milestones, including Mutual Success Plans, Solution Health Reviews and Strategic Business Reviews, while partnering with Sales for renewals and expansions. They will also proactively identify customers who are not seeing value and develop mitigation plans to resolve risk.
